Hi everyone, I'm having an issue with my recently bought lg motion and is scarying me. My phone's speed seems to be capped somehow, and I mean both 4G and WiFi. When I run a speed test with the speedtest.net app all I get is 3800Kb/s as a max, it never goes higher than that both in 4G and WiFi(I have a 10Mb/s internet at home meassuered by sppeedtest.net in my PC). Now the issue, I think, was the software update I applied short after I got the phone, since it poped in my screen and I didn't see a reason not to update. Before I applied the update, well as soon as I got the phone I ran an speed test to see how much I was getting and yeah, my first speed test was(4G) 8200Kb/s which was awsome. Then when I got home the same day I ran a speed test of my WiFi at home and bang, 11200Kb/s which is my 10Mb/s plan I have at home. So y question is: Why in the world am I just getting 3800Kb/s connected to my WiFi at home ? This is scary to say the least, and I'm kindly asking for anybody that can helped my with this or at least has seen or noticed something similar. Thanks.
 
Nop, It doesn't seem to be the update, my sister's phone has not get the update yet(she bought it the same day I did) and is also hitting the 3800Kb/s top limit. I also restarted to factory my phone and first thing I did was run some speed tests and the first one I did gave me my full wifi speed 11Mb/s but the the second one droped to the same 3800Kb/s. Well at this point I restarted the wifi and the first 2 tests gave me full speed, then the 3rd droped again and then restarting the wifi didn't do the trick after that. I also did other tests under different sircumstances, like torrent downloads, some DDL videos, drivers packs from nvidia page, etc. but same result.
